Overall Satisfaction with EZ Texting

We're a housing authority. We have implemented EZ Texting to inform residents of: upcoming events, appointment reminders, service provider announcements, organizational announcements etc... We believe it will allow for us to keep them more up-to-date on any organizational updates/closures. We schedule programming with outside vendors, we will be able to provide them any updates from the providers
  • Sending out announcements and reminders
  • Allowing residents to save our "ez-tezt" number and tezt us if they're number changes
  • We can send flyers and videos to tenants about service offerings
  • I don't like that you have to pay for multiple people to access the database
  • While it's pretty user-friendly, it can always be more so
  • Allow for better customization of the sign-up forms
  • Reduction in costs due to less mailing
  • Quicker response times
  • Added engagement

When I'm crafting a message, AI allows me to save time by not having to wordsmith as much. It also allows for different tones for different situations. I'm not to fond of all the emojis; however, there are some use cases where they may be helpful
I'm more familiar with EZ Texting than Simple Texting. Also, I think the pricing was a little more favorable
